The Seven Deadly Sins: Origin launches first for PS5 & PC Steam on March 16, followed with mobile on March 23
Netmarble has confirmed the full release dates for The Seven Deadly Sins: Origin. The online game will be available first on PlayStation 5 and PC via Steam on March 16, followed with a grand mobile launch for iOS, Android, and PC via Google Play Games a week later on March 23.
This announcement confirms the new release date for The Seven Deadly Sins-based free-to-play game, after it missed its initial January release date with a delay to March. Take note that Netmarble is marking the latter mobile releases as the Grand Launch, while the earlier PS5 and PC Steam releases are heavily implied as Early Accesses.

Play Earlier on Monday, March 16, 2026, on PlayStation®5, Steam
Grand Launch on Monday, March 23, 2026, on Apple App Store (iOS), Google Play (AOS), Google Play Games (GPG)
